Sat, Mar 05, 2011 at 03:33:30PM CET, nicolas.2p.debian@gmail.com wrote:
>Le 05/03/2011 11:29, Jiri Pirko a écrit :
>>Since now when bonding uses rx_handler, all traffic going into bond
>>device goes thru bond_handle_frame. So there's no need to go back into
>>bonding code later via ptype handlers. This patch converts
>>original ptype handlers into "bonding receive probes". These functions
>>are called from bond_handle_frame and they are registered per-mode.
>
>Does this still support having the arp_ip_target on a vlan?
>
>(eth0 -> bond0 -> bond0.100, with arp_ip_target only reachable through bond0.100).

This case is still covered with vlan_on_bond_hook
eth0->
	bond_handle_frame
bond0->
	vlan_hwaccel_do_receive
bond0.5->
	vlan_on_bond_hook -> reinject into bond0
				-> bond_handle_frame (here it is processed)
